John Bodkin Adams, also British, is thought to have killed 163 patients. Harold Shipman, a British general practitioner, is thought to have killed up to 250 of his patients. Some of the worst serial killers have been doctors. To law enforcement officers a serial killer's habits are known as his signature, and they are always valuable leads in detecting who he is and capturing him. Some serial killers have had very strange habits which leave evidence of their work at each crime for instance Albert de Salvo, the Boston Strangler, would tie the cord with which he had strangled a woman around her neck in a special bow. He may always use the same kind of weapon to kill his victims, or may treat them in a certain manner, such as tying them up with the same kind of rope or adhesive tape. The killer may only attack a certain type of person, for instance women of a certain age or appearance (young or old, blonde or dark-haired).
